The DFW Tornados was founded as the American Eagles Soccer Club in 1990. It now has 25 select teams, a "Tiny Twisters" program for 3-5 year olds, an academy for 6-9 year olds and a men’s professional team. Our club is one of the largest in the DFW Metroplex and has earned a reputation for placing our players in collegiate soccer programs.

Tryouts are held annually, in July. Camps and Skills Clinics are held throughout the year to help players prepare for tryouts. We currently have teams playing in the Dallas Chamber Classic, Lake Highlands, Arlington and Plano leagues.

The DFW Tornados Congratulate Jay Needham and Daniel Woolard!
The DFW Tornados Semi-Professional men’s PDL team sent 7 players to the United Soccer League (USL) Professional Combine. The Tornados had the most players invited to the combine of any of the 62 Premier Development League (PDL) teams in North America!

Head Coach Paul Robinson and owner Jim Mertz are very excited that the Tornados are able to provide the opportunity for their players to play professional soccer.

Jay Needham and Daniel Woolard are two of our players who took advantage of this opportunity. Both are heading to Major League Soccer (MLS) teams. Needham has been drafted by D.C. United and Woolard has been drafted by Chicago Fire.
